Around the turn of the century, Autonomy Corporation was one of the darlings of the UK technology industry, specializing in knowledge management and enterprise search. Rather than selling software to customers, HP said, Autonomy had been selling them hardware at a loss, then booking the sales as software licensing revenue.

This is how developers often describe the open-source programming language introduced in 2012 by Microsoft. Technically, TypeScript is a variant of JavaScript, the number one language for many years in a row. Currently, browsers aren’t able to read TypeScript code, so before releasing it needs to be converted to plain JavaScript.

The growth in demand for software has consistently outpaced the growth in the supply of software developers. Each major expansion in software development - automation (60s), productivity (80s), internet (90s), mobile (00s) - has been additive to the total stock of software in the world.
